Louis Albert Rennau

June 7, 1939 — January 7, 2014

Louis "Lou" Albert Rennau, 74, of Hannibal, Mo passed away Tuesday, January 7, 2014 at Levering Regional Healthcare Center. Funeral services will be held 11:00 a.m. Monday, January 13, 2014 at the Smith Funeral Home and Chapel, Bro. Justin Mosher will officiate. Burial will be in the Grand View Burial Park. There will be no visitation. Louis was born June 7, 1939 in Hannibal, Mo the son of William Louis and Ruby May (Shrum) Rennau. Survivors include one daughter; special friends, Kathy Wendt Bown and husband Dick of Black Hawk, SD and Mike Sohn of Hannibal, MO; Hannibal High friends; loving friends and staff at Levering Regional Healthcare; and two nieces. Mr. Rennau was preceded in death by his parents. Louis was a member of Fifth Street Baptist Church. He was a very talented athlete and musician. Lou graduated from Hannibal High School in 1957. He went on to play baseball for the Chicago White Sox minor league team. Lou played electric piano and vocals in the Roadrunners band and later formed Goldilocks and The Three Bears.
